Any interst in this High end 8.4 inch VGA screen with touch?
I have a source for these,.....
8.4 inch 4:3 screen
Poly Si TFT
800 x 600 native res
350 nits
250:1 contrast
70 degree left right viewing angle
found controllers with on screen menu
and touchscreen kit
I will have to purchase at least 10

Still working on the price,....
However, this is a special high bright, high res, high view angle display....
I am guessing at least $500 for just the screen with controller board...
(this is not a cheap screen! I can't emphasize this enough)
+ or - 70 degrees on the horizontal viewing angle!
I may just source the touch screen from another vendor (around $100)
I am just trying to see if there is interest in a high quality display, one
that will not be the cheapest thing on the block. The size is not set in
stone, just the first option that I have found.
this module is approx. 8" x 6" and will fit easily in most dash situations.
I will try to post some more info today.
Is this a size that you would be interested in????
